  5. 19 de abr. de 2024 · Rostov-na-Donu is the oblast ’s administrative centre and largest city. It and Taganrog are major ports. Agriculture is highly developed in Rostov and is dominated by grains, wheat, barley, and corn (maize), which occupy two-thirds of the arable land in the oblast. Sunflowers, mustard, and melons are also economically important.
